" Callous approach" towards the plight of casual/ Contractual workers unacceptable: Javid Beigh


Srinagar, March 19 ( RNA): Asking Lt. Governor to show sensitivity towards the plight of casual, daily rated and consolidated workers engaged in different departments, Senior Apni Party leader and former MLA Javid Hassan Beigh Saturday said that , " Callous approach towards these poor people " won't work, urging government to be " humane" while dealing with their issue. Speaking to RNA, Mr. Beigh while lauding the contribution of these temporary employees towards society said that time has come when government should re-pay to them instead of leaving them isolated and helpless.

" You have snowfall, rains , hot weather days, these contractuals, daily wagers are there to fix your water pipelines, electric lines, roads, bridges, hospitals , forests and much more." Beigh said while refering to the work the daily wagers do in their respective departments. He however, said that despite all the hardwork, they have been getting meagre amount as remuneration but what has now complicated their plight is that Government is advertising the posts and recruiting fresh candidates leaving them helpless. He urged Lt. Governor to not allow buracucates to be " callous" on the issue and asked , " What is the difference between the previous governments which -they blame have not done enough for the people- and this one which doesn't seem willing to do enough for them either ." Javid Beigh told RNA. He  appealed LG to consider their confirmation so that they do not suffer any more.
